discomfitor pushed a commit to branch master. http://git.enlightenment.org/apps/empc.git/commit/?id=3616fc1d4f4af63ff916c5b1f5e8f0d14a1af802
commit 3616fc1d4f4af63ff916c5b1f5e8f0d14a1af802 Author: zmike <michael.blumenkra...@gmail.com> Date: Sun Mar 8 22:31:55 2015 -0400 use BOTH aspect mode for ee images I think this looks better for corner cases? --- src/bin/empc.c |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/src/bin/empc.c b/src/bin/empc.c index e4b3cad..b5f1ef5 100644 --- a/src/bin/empc.c +++ b/src/bin/empc.c @@ -179,7 +179,7 @@ ee_image_copy(Evas_Object *obj, Evas_Object *o, int size) evas_object_image_mmap_get(orig, &file, &g); copy = evas_object_image_filled_add(ecore_evas_object_evas_get(o)); elm_image_object_size_get(obj, &w, &h); - evas_object_size_hint_aspect_set(o, EVAS_ASPECT_CONTROL_HORIZONTAL, w, h); + evas_object_size_hint_aspect_set(o, EVAS_ASPECT_CONTROL_BOTH, w, h); size *= elm_config_scale_get(); if (w > h) { @@ -1455,7 +1455,7 @@ filesystem_item_image(void *data, Empc_Fetch_Request *req, Evas_Object *obj) evas_object_show(o); evas_object_box_append(data, o); evas_object_size_hint_aspect_get(o, NULL, &w, &h); - evas_object_size_hint_aspect_set(data, EVAS_ASPECT_CONTROL_HORIZONTAL, w, h); + evas_object_size_hint_aspect_set(data, EVAS_ASPECT_CONTROL_BOTH, w, h); evas_object_event_callback_add(data, EVAS_CALLBACK_DEL, item_box_del, o); if (req) save_image(EINA_FALSE, obj, NULL, req->artist, req->album, NULL); --